Print policy violations only if any rule was violated (AST-66024) #3616
Triggered via pull request
September 22, 2024 10:53
Status
Failure
Total duration
3m 15s
Artifacts
–
ci.yml
on: pull_request
unit-tests
16s
integration-tests
5s
lint
3m 7s
govulncheck
2m 43s
scan Docker Image with Trivy
18s
Annotations
31 errors and 15 warnings
integration-tests:
internal/wrappers/container-resolver.go#L4
missing go.sum entry for module providing package github.com/CheckmarxDev/containers-resolver/pkg/containerResolver (imported by github.com/checkmarx/ast-cli/internal/wrappers); to add:
|
integration-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L12
missing go.sum entry for module providing package google.golang.org/grpc (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
integration-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L13
missing go.sum entry for module providing package google.golang.org/grpc/codes (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
integration-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L14
missing go.sum entry for module providing package google.golang.org/grpc/status (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
integration-tests: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L13
missing go.sum entry for module providing package google.golang.org/protobuf/reflect/protoreflect (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
integration-tests: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L14
missing go.sum entry for module providing package google.golang.org/protobuf/runtime/protoimpl (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
integration-tests:
internal/wrappers/grpcs/client.go#L10
missing go.sum entry for module providing package google.golang.org/grpc/credentials (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
integration-tests:
internal/wrappers/grpcs/client.go#L11
missing go.sum entry for module providing package google.golang.org/grpc/credentials/insecure (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
integration-tests:
internal/wrappers/grpcs/client.go#L12
missing go.sum entry for module providing package google.golang.org/grpc/health/grpc_health_v*** (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
integration-tests
Process completed with exit code ***.
|
unit-tests:
internal/wrappers/container-resolver.go#L4
missing go.sum entry for module providing package github.com/CheckmarxDev/containers-resolver/pkg/containerResolver (imported by github.com/checkmarx/ast-cli/internal/wrappers); to add:
|
unit-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L12
missing go.sum entry for module providing package google.golang.org/grpc (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
unit-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L13
missing go.sum entry for module providing package google.golang.org/grpc/codes (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
unit-tests: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L14
missing go.sum entry for module providing package google.golang.org/grpc/status (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
unit-tests: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L13
missing go.sum entry for module providing package google.golang.org/protobuf/reflect/protoreflect (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
unit-tests: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L14
missing go.sum entry for module providing package google.golang.org/protobuf/runtime/protoimpl (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
unit-tests:
internal/wrappers/grpcs/client.go#L10
missing go.sum entry for module providing package google.golang.org/grpc/credentials (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
unit-tests:
internal/wrappers/grpcs/client.go#L11
missing go.sum entry for module providing package google.golang.org/grpc/credentials/insecure (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
unit-tests:
internal/wrappers/grpcs/client.go#L12
missing go.sum entry for module providing package google.golang.org/grpc/health/grpc_health_v1 (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
unit-tests:
internal/wrappers/container-resolver.go#L4
missing go.sum entry for module providing package github.com/CheckmarxDev/containers-resolver/pkg/containerResolver (imported by github.com/checkmarx/ast-cli/internal/wrappers); to add:
|
scan Docker Image with Trivy
Process completed with exit code 1.
|
govulncheck:
internal/wrappers/container-resolver.go#L4
missing go.sum entry for module providing package github.com/CheckmarxDev/containers-resolver/pkg/containerResolver (imported by github.com/checkmarx/ast-cli/internal/wrappers); to add:
|
govulncheck:
internal/wrappers/container-resolver.go#L4
could not import github.com/CheckmarxDev/containers-resolver/pkg/containerResolver (invalid package name: "")
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L12
missing go.sum entry for module providing package google.golang.org/grpc (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s); to add:
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L13
missing go.sum entry for module providing package google.golang.org/grpc/codes (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L14
missing go.sum entry for module providing package google.golang.org/grpc/status (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L13
missing go.sum entry for module providing package google.golang.org/protobuf/reflect/protoreflect (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L14
missing go.sum entry for module providing package google.golang.org/protobuf/runtime/protoimpl (imported by github.com/checkmarx/ast-cli/internal/wrappers/grpcs/protos/asca/managements); to add:
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L13
could not import google.golang.org/protobuf/reflect/protoreflect (invalid package name: "")
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management.pb.go#L14
could not import google.golang.org/protobuf/runtime/protoimpl (invalid package name: "")
|
govulncheck:
internal/wrappers/grpcs/protos/asca/managements/management_grpc.pb.go#L12
could not import google.golang.org/grpc (invalid package name: "")
|
integration-tests
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/setup-go@4d34df0c23***6fe8***22ab82dc22947d607c0c9***f9.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node***6-by-default/
|
unit-tests
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/setup-go@4d34df0c2316fe8122ab82dc22947d607c0c91f9.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|
scan Docker Image with Trivy
The following actions uses node12 which is deprecated and will be forced to run on node16: actions/checkout@722adc63f1aa60a57ec37892e133b1d319cae598, docker/setup-buildx-action@cf09c5c41b299b55c366aff30022701412eb6ab0. For more info: https://github.blog/changelog/2023-06-13-github-actions-all-actions-will-run-on-node16-instead-of-node12-by-default/
|
scan Docker Image with Trivy
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@722adc63f1aa60a57ec37892e133b1d319cae598, docker/setup-buildx-action@cf09c5c41b299b55c366aff30022701412eb6ab0, docker/login-action@49ed152c8eca782a232dede0303416e8f356c37b.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`set-output`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
scan Docker Image with Trivy
The `save-state` command is deprecated and will be disabled soon. Please upgrade to using Environment Files. For more information see: https://github.blog/changelog/2022-10-11-github-actions-deprecating-save-state-and-set-output-commands/
|
govulncheck
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/checkout@v3, actions/setup-go@v4.0.0.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|
lint
The following actions use a deprecated Node.js version and will be forced to run on node20: actions/setup-go@4d34df0c2316fe8122ab82dc22947d607c0c91f9, golangci/golangci-lint-action@3a919529898de77ec3da873e3063ca4b10e7f5cc. For more info: https://github.blog/changelog/2024-03-07-github-actions-all-actions-will-run-on-node20-instead-of-node16-by-default/
|